如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

CSS特效合集:让你的网页绽放光彩

探索CSS特效合集:让你的网页绽放光彩

在现代网页设计中,CSS特效已经成为不可或缺的一部分。它们不仅能提升用户体验,还能让网页在视觉上更加吸引人。今天,我们将深入探讨CSS特效合集,为大家介绍一些常见的特效及其应用。

什么是CSS特效?

CSS(Cascading Style Sheets)特效是通过CSS代码实现的视觉效果和动画。它们利用CSS的各种属性,如transitionanimationtransform等,来创造动态的、交互式的网页元素。CSS特效可以包括但不限于:

  • 过渡效果(Transition):让元素在状态变化时平滑过渡。
  • 动画效果(Animation):创建复杂的动画序列。
  • 变换效果(Transform):改变元素的形状、大小、位置等。
  • 阴影效果(Box Shadow):为元素添加阴影,增强立体感。
  • 滤镜效果(Filter):应用各种滤镜效果,如模糊、灰度、亮度等。

CSS特效的应用

  1. 导航菜单动画: 许多网站的导航菜单会使用CSS特效来增强用户体验。例如,当鼠标悬停在菜单项上时,菜单项可能会有颜色变化、缩放或滑动效果。这种特效不仅美观,还能帮助用户更直观地了解导航结构。

  2. 按钮交互效果: 按钮是用户与网页交互的重要元素。通过CSS特效,可以让按钮在点击或悬停时产生视觉反馈,如颜色变化、阴影效果、缩放等,提高用户的点击欲望和操作的直观性。

  3. 图片展示效果: 图片轮播、图片放大镜、图片滤镜等都是CSS特效的典型应用。通过这些特效,用户可以更有趣、更直观地浏览图片内容。

  4. 加载动画: 在网页加载过程中,使用CSS特效制作的加载动画可以让用户在等待时不感到枯燥。常见的有旋转的圆圈、进度条等。

  5. 响应式设计CSS特效在响应式设计中也大有作为。例如,当屏幕尺寸变化时,元素可以平滑地调整位置或大小,确保网页在不同设备上都能呈现最佳效果。

如何学习和应用CSS特效

学习CSS特效并不难,关键在于理解CSS的基本原理和特效的实现方式。以下是一些学习和应用的建议:

  • 基础知识:首先掌握CSS的基本语法和属性。
  • 实践:通过实际项目或小练习来应用所学知识。
  • 资源:利用在线资源,如CodePen、CSS-Tricks等,查看并学习他人的作品。
  • 工具:使用CSS预处理器如Sass或Less,可以更高效地编写和管理CSS代码。
  • 社区:加入开发者社区,参与讨论,分享经验。

结语

CSS特效合集为网页设计提供了无限的可能性。无论是简单的过渡效果,还是复杂的动画序列,都能通过CSS实现。通过不断学习和实践,你可以让你的网页不仅功能强大,还能在视觉上给用户带来惊喜和愉悦。希望这篇文章能激发你对CSS特效的兴趣,并在你的项目中大展身手。记住,好的设计不仅是功能的实现,更是用户体验的提升。